There are now 4 (yes, 4) proposed amendments to PA's Constitution and 2 of them will revoke the Governor's emergency powers - handing them to the General Assembly which has /1
been predominantly GOP led for decades. The equality provision is ALREADY LAW. The words business and education appear ZERO times in the proposed amendments. The other provision, is whether or not to increase the size of loans volunteer emergency companies can be eligible for. /2
Does this mailer scream out stripping the Governor's emergency powers and increased loan amounts for volunteer organizations to you? Sure, the latter can protect our schools and businesses - if they're on fire or someone needs an EMT. Vote YES for the loans and the pretty /3
equality paragraph that changes nothing. Vote NO to handing the emergency powers of the Governor to the party that is misrepresenting their proposals - right down to how many there are. Read them yourself via the link in the first tweet of this thread.
